After successful award ceremonies for the best learning moment in OS in 2010 and 2011 is it time for more depth this year.

We are looking for a small number of show cases: projects and initiatives that embody the philosophy of the Institute of Brilliant Failures – with the best intentions and good preparation, get unexpected results, which leads to a learning moment. The cases will be discussed and presented in detail during Partos Plaza on 4 October in Amsterdam. Following the discussion, the public will choose the best case.
